Technical Specification Table – Typical Silicone & Plastic Molds
| Parameter | Silicone (LSR) Mold | Engineering Plastic Mold |
|---|---|---|
| Material Grade | Medical‑grade LSR (ISO 10993‑1) | PP, PC, ABS (UL‑94 V‑0) |
| Cavity Size | ≤ 300 mm × 300 mm × 200 mm | ≤ 500 mm × 500 mm × 300 mm |
| Shot Volume | 0.5 – 150 cm³ | 1 – 500 cm³ |
| Cycle Time | 2 – 8 s (typical 4 s) | 3 – 12 s (typical 6 s) |
| Tolerances | ± 0.02 mm (± 0.001 in) | ± 0.03 mm (± 0.0012 in) |
| Surface Finish | Ra ≤ 0.4 µm (mirror finish) | Ra ≤ 0.8 µm (polished) |
| Tool Life | > 2 M shots (silicone) | > 3 M shots (plastic) |
| Typical Cost | US $ 12,000 – 30,000 | US $ 8,000 – 25,000 |

Frequently Asked Questions
What is the typical lead time for a custom injection molding mold?
Standard steel molds (up to 3 cavities) are delivered in 15‑21 days after design approval. For high‑volume multi‑cavity tools, we allocate 30‑35 days, including heat‑treatment and surface polishing.
Can you provide low‑temperature cure LSR for multi‑shot molding?
Yes. Our R&D team uses the low‑temp cure formulation described in KCI research, enabling dual‑material injection at 120 °C, reducing cycle energy by 22 %.
How do you ensure dimensional stability for optical‑grade silicone lenses?
We integrate AI‑driven process optimization (see arXiv 2025) that monitors cavity pressure, temperature gradients, and cure kinetics in real time, keeping shrinkage < 0.05 %.
